How To Connect Hp Officejet J4550 To A Wireless Network

The J4550 does not come with wireless capability (the J4680 is the only printer in that series that does) but you can make your J4550 work on a wireless network by attaching it to a wireless print server, such as the TP-Link TL-WPS510U 150Mbps Wireless Print Server. Initially there is some setup involved to change your print drivers and install the print server, but once you've done that it's ready to go and you can print over your wireless network.
